		<description>Lots of great advice Deborah!  In Australia it can be difficult to find preschool jobs.  Preschools here have hours and holidays very similar to schools so teaching in a preschool, as opposed to long day care is very attractive for working mums (like myself).

I&#039;ve got another hint:  Personally introduce yourself to the preschools in your area and ask if they have a list for relief staff.  We find it hard to find relief teachers who live locally and who are enthusiastic, motivated and show initiative.  Often the agencies send us relief staff who are sadly lacking in all of the above, so it can really be a chance to shine and showcase your teaching.  If a job comes up, you will be fresh in their minds.</description>
